(Photo by Joe Raedle/Getty Images)Michigan lawmakers are now fighting to eliminate gender-specified toys in a kid's meal. State representatives would like for restaurants to start offering the customer a choice of toy instead of asking is the toy for a "boy" or "girl." The resolution states that some Michigan establishments have stopped the practice, but many in the state still use the method.
